PAMA presented its annual awards on Friday at BrewDog Las Vegas.
The Preventative Automotive Maintenance Association welcomed iFLEX 2025 attendees to Las Vegas on Friday evening with its President’s Reception event, and the association recognized several operators during the event.
The PAMA Awards recognize association members who are actively involved with PAMA and their community, and thrive to innovate in the industry. The following award recipients were honored during the reception, which was held at BrewDog Las Vegas:
Distinguished Service: Eric Frankenberger, Oil Changers
Operator of the Year: Ron Morrow, Jr., Oilex Operating LLC
Advocate of the Year: Matt Webb, Premier Oil Change
Vendor of the Year: Service Champ
Up & Coming: Levi Wilson, Benny's Car Wash & Oil Change
The honorees were also recognized during the PAMA Membership Breakfast on Saturday morning at the Las Vegas Convention Center.
